TitleMarijuana: Facts for Teens / La Marijuana: Informacion Para los Adolescentes
Accession Number:PMD09446
Abstract:This booklet explains the facts about marijuana. It explains what marijuana is, how many teens smoke marijuana, what happens when a person smokes marijuana, what the short- and long-term effects are, how to tell if someone has been smoking marijuana, and how to quit using it.
